The Engine Brake Master Piston, part number 3078316, manufactured by Cummins, is a critical component in the engine braking system of heavy-duty trucks. This part facilitates the operation of the engine brake, a mechanism that slows down or controls the speed of a vehicle by converting engine power into heat through compression. Purpose of the Engine Brake Master Piston
This Cummins part plays a role in the operation of a truck by aiding in deceleration and engine braking. It allows the driver to reduce speed without relying solely on the traditional braking system, which can lead to brake fade under heavy or prolonged use. By using the engine to slow the vehicle, the master piston helps maintain control during descents and in situations where traditional brakes may not be sufficient 2.

Benefits
The advantages provided by the Engine Brake Master Piston include improved braking efficiency, reduced wear on traditional braking systems, and enhanced safety during descents. By utilizing the engine for deceleration, it extends the life of the friction brakes and provides a more controlled braking experience, especially in heavy-duty applications 4.
